The variable that is kept the same in an experiment is known as a controlled variable, not an independent or dependent variable. The independent variable is the one that is manipulated by the researcher to observe its effect, while the dependent variable is the outcome that is measured in response to changes in the independent variable. Controlled variables help ensure that the results are due to the independent variable alone.
In research and experiments, an independent variable is the factor that is manipulated or changed to observe its effect on another variable. The dependent variable is the outcome or response that is measured to assess the impact of the independent variable. Essentially, the independent variable is presumed to cause changes in the dependent variable. For example, in a study examining the effect of study time (independent variable) on test scores (dependent variable), the amount of study time is what the researcher alters to see how it affects scores.
